VADA NOBLES PRODUCES JAY-Z’S NEWEST SIGNING
The man behind the miseducation…

PR: JOHN HOUSTON ENTERTAINMENT
Jonathan Hay – johnhoustonent@gmail.com

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E
(ORLANDO, FL) – March 16, 2005 – Vada Nobles, the multi-platinum international super-producer, has been coined, “the man behind the miseducation,” for his work with Lauryn Hill. Nobles has been heralded as the main producer on the groundbreaking album, “Miseducation of Lauryn Hill,” a monumental record which sold over 16 million copies worldwide and won five Grammy Awards, three American Music Awards, a Billboard Award, a Soul Train Award, and an MTV Music Award. Now this critically acclaimed producer is gearing up to pair with hip-hop icon and industry heavyweight, Jay-Z, and others to put forth the hottest new music sensation in recent years.

Nobles’ current undertaking is the Def Jam (now headed by Jay-Z) family’s newest addition, a 16-year old, Barbados-based soulful sensation named Rihanna, who Nobles claims, “is a young superstar on the rise!”

Rihanna radiantly performed in Def Jam’s office for a handful of music moguls including Jay-Z, L.A. Reid, Evan Rogers and Carl Sturken. The story of her signing will go down in history as one of those magical moments that almost sounds like a fairytale. However, this is real, as the Def Jam staff decided they didn’t want Rihanna to leave the building until they had her signed to this powerhouse label. Def Jam called in both their legal team and the artist’s attorney to work out a deal, literally right there on the spot. This historical deal is rumored to be one of the largest deals ever signed by an “up-and-coming artist.” As one Def Jam employee put it, “[Rihanna] got a ‘LeBron James’ deal.” So the contracts were signed at approximately 3:30 am, as no one was permitted to leave the building until the deal had been finalized. The entire process was a feat almost unheard of in the music business.

Rihanna could have stirred up a serious bidding war, as Sony and about five other major record labels were courting her, but it was Def Jam that was relentless to get this deal done…and in one long, special night it was.

Vada Nobles comments, “It’s a privilege to be working with Jay-Z, L.A. Reid, and Sturken and Rogers who are such talented people with great musical appetite, passion, and determination to bring forth a promising superstar such as Rihanna.”

Rihanna is certainly in good hands; aside from the success earned from Lauryn Hill, Nobles has also produced such prominent artists as Aretha Franklin, Faith Evans, CeCe Winans, LL Cool J and Slick Rick, among many other legendary superstars that literally span the globe.

Rihanna’s first single is called, “Pon de Replay,” produced by Nobles which will be released to radio stations in upcoming weeks, prior to which Rihanna will be embarking on a promotional tour all across the United States. Paralleling the massive demand for the future star Rihanna, Vada Nobles’ production is being heavily sought out. He is esteemed to have single-handedly changed the sound of modern music as we know it.

So with all these stars aligned, I guess this story proves that dreams really do come true after all…
